.footstamp {margin-left:25px;}
table.main_title {margin-left:25px;}
#ShopKeeper {margin-left:25px;}
.product_place{margin-left:25px;}
.pagenavi{margin-left:25px;}
.sort_01{margin-left:25px;}


table.zip{margin-left:0px;width:612px;border-right:2px solid #fff;border-bottom:2px solid #fff;}
table.zip th{text-align:center;padding:10px 20px;background-color:#ccffcc;border-left:2px solid #fff;border-top:2px solid #fff;}
table.zip td{text-align:left;padding:10px 20px;background-color:#E1FAE3;border-left:2px solid #fff;border-top:2px solid #fff;}




.toponly01 {
color: #333;
 line-height: 1.35;
font-size:16px;
font-weight: bold;
width: 640px;
text-align: left;
padding:9px 0px 0px 17px;
letter-spacing: 0.04em;
}


.toponly02 {
line-height: 1.35;
color: #333;
font-size:15px;
font-weight: normal;
width: 640px;
text-align: left;
padding:9px 0px 0px 17px;
letter-spacing: 0.05em;
}


.toponly03 {
line-height: 1.35;
color: #f33;
font-size:15px;
font-weight: normal;
width: 640px;
text-align: left;
padding:9px 0px 0px 17px;
letter-spacing: 0.05em;
}

.box01 {
    padding: 1em 0.3em;
    margin: 2em 0;
    background: #F0FFF5;
    border: dashed 2px #28A181;/*点線*/
}

.box01 p {
    margin: 0; 
    padding: 0px 9px 0px 0px;
    font-size:15px;
    line-height: 1.45em;
}


/* ---h3画像トップページレイアウト用--- */
.lyout_1 {
width: 100%;
text-align: left;
margin: 0px 0px 0px 0px;
padding: 14px 0px 12px 0px;
}





/* ---風水果実アートバナー説明テキスト用--- */
.fw_super {
line-height: 1.3;
color: #3F0000;
font-size:16px;
font-weight: normal;
width: 620px;
text-align: left;
letter-spacing: 0.05em;
padding:2px 0px 0px 36px;
}

.swpc01 {
padding:0px 0px 0px 36px;
margin:-13px 0px 0px 0px;
}

/* ---風水果実ストラップバナーリンクテキスト用--- */
.strap_pc1 {
line-height: 1.4;
color: #ff0033;
font-size:16px;
font-weight: normal;
text-align: left;
padding:2px 0px 18px 17px;
}
